PYSEC-2026-2545 kedro-datasets has a path traversal vulnerability in PartitionedDataset that allows arbitrary file write
Impact PartitionedDataset in kedro-datasets was vulnerable to path traversal. Partition IDs were concatenated directly with the dataset base path without validation. An attacker or malicious input containing .. components in a partition ID could cause files to be written outside the configured...

PYSEC-2026-2656 Arbitrary file write via tar traversal in mlflow
A vulnerability in MLflow's pyfunc extraction process allows for arbitrary file writes due to improper handling of tar archive entries. Specifically, the use of tarfile.extractall without path validation enables crafted tar.gz files containing .. or absolute paths to escape the intended extractio...
